Furnace Starts Then Shuts Off After a Few Seconds in Punaluu, HI

A furnace that initiates the startup sequence and shuts off within seconds almost always has a flame sensor problem in Punaluu. The furnace ignites the burners, the flame sensor fails to confirm the flame within the safety window, and the control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ure in Punaluu, HI. Flame sensor cleaning or replacement addresses this in most cases in Punaluu.

Furnace Short Cycling in Punaluu

The most common cause is the high-limit switch tripping because restricted airflow is causing the heat exchanger to overheat in Punaluu, HI. A dirty air filter severely restricting return airflow is the most common cause of limit switch tripping in Punaluu.

Unusual Noises From the Furnace in Punaluu

A banging or booming sound at startup indicates delayed ignition from dirty burners in Punaluu, HI. A squealing sound from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Punaluu. A rattling sound during operation may indicate a loose heat exchanger component in Punaluu, HI.

What Causes Furnace Failures

What Causes Furnace Failures in Punaluu, HI

Failed or Dirty Flame Sensor in Punaluu

The flame sensor confirms a flame is present before the control board allows the gas valve to stay open in Punaluu, HI. Oxidation on the sensor rod reduces its electrical conductivity over time, causing a signal too weak to satisfy the control board in Punaluu. The control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ure, producing the furnace that starts and shuts off within seconds symptom in Punaluu, HI.

Failed Hot Surface Igniter in Punaluu, HI

The hot surface igniter is a fragile ceramic component that glows red-hot to ignite the gas burners in Punaluu. Igniters become brittle over time from thermal cycling and crack or fail from physical shock in Punaluu, HI. A failed igniter produces no glow and no ignition in Punaluu.

Cracked Heat Exchanger in Punaluu

The heat exchanger separates the combustion gases from the circulated air in Punaluu, HI. A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to cross into the circulated air and be distributed throughout the home by the blower in Punaluu. A confirmed cracked heat exchanger means the furnace should not be operated until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Punaluu, HI.

Blower Motor and Capacitor Failure in Punaluu, HI

A failed blower motor produces no airflow despite the combustion system operating correctly, causing the heat exchanger to overheat and the high-limit switch to trip in Punaluu. A failing blower capacitor causes the motor to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Punaluu, HI.

Control Board and Thermostat Faults in Punaluu

The control board manages ignition sequencing, blower timing, safety switch monitoring, and fault code storage in Punaluu, HI. A failed control board can produce a wide range of symptoms depending on which function it was managing in Punaluu.

Limit Switch Trips From Overheating in Punaluu, HI

The high-limit switch shuts the furnace off if the heat exchanger temperature exceeds the safe maximum in Punaluu. It trips consistently when the heat exchanger is reaching unsafe temperatures, almost always from restricted airflow in Punaluu, HI. A dirty air filter is the most common cause in Punaluu.

A banging or booming sound at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Punaluu. Gas accumulates in the combustion chamber before the burners ignite because the burner ports are partially blocked by combustion deposits in Punaluu, HI. When ignition finally occurs, the accumulated gas ignites with a small explosion in Punaluu. Delayed ignition is hard on the heat exchanger and warrants prompt burner cleaning in Punaluu, HI.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the heat exchanger below the minimum required for safe operation in Punaluu. The heat exchanger temperature rises to the point where the high-limit switch trips and shuts the furnace off in Punaluu, HI. Replacing the filter allows the furnace to restart in Punaluu.
